Understanding Aruba Technologies
Access Points: The Backbone of Wireless Networking
Aruba’s access points play a crucial role in extending connectivity throughout your organization. Featuring advanced capabilities such as:
- Wi-Fi 6 and 6E support for higher throughput and lower latency
- Intelligent RF management to optimize coverage
- AI-powered analytics for performance monitoring
These access points ensure that your employees can work efficiently, regardless of their location within the premises.

Aruba Central: The Brain Behind Management
Aruba Central is a cloud-based management solution that simplifies network operations. Key advantages include:
- Centralized visibility of all devices and users
- Automated updates and configurations
- Proactive monitoring and alerts to mitigate issues before they impact users
This holistic view enhances control and allows IT teams to focus on strategic initiatives rather than day-to-day troubleshooting.
Wi-Fi 6/6E: Future-Proofing Your Network
Wi-Fi 6 and 6E represent the next generation of wireless standards, delivering up to four times the speed compared to previous generations. They support more simultaneous connections, reducing congestion in high-density areas like offices, schools, and public venues. Features such as:
- OFDMA for efficient bandwidth usage
- Target Wake Time (TWT) to improve battery life for connected devices

1. What is Wi-Fi 6, and why is it important for businesses?
Wi-Fi 6 offers faster speeds, increased capacity for more devices, and lower latency, making it ideal for high-density environments typical in business settings.
2. How does Aruba Central simplify network management?
Aruba Central provides a cloud-based platform that offers centralized management, visibility, and monitoring of network components, simplifying operational tasks.
